Fischer Twin Skin Pro Cross-Country Skis

These lightweight cross-country skis from Fischer feature a Twin Skin Pro base with integrated mohair skins for optimal kick and glide performance on groomed trails. Designed specifically for cross-country skiing, they include lightweight wood cores and air channels for efficient touring. Classified under HTS 9506.19.4000 as cross-country snow-ski equipment.

Alternative Classifications

This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.

9506.11.40Higher: 20.1% vs 17.5%

If equipped with metal edges and shaped for downhill carving

Skis with metal edges and alpine geometry classify as 'snow-skis' for downhill under 9506.11, not touring cross-country.

9506.91.00Higher: 22.1% vs 17.5%

If imported as individual replacement ski without bindings

Separate ski parts or accessories not assembled classify under parts heading 9506.91 instead of complete equipment.

Import Tips & Compliance

Verify skis meet cross-country specs (lightweight, touring-focused) vs alpine to avoid reclassification; provide manufacturer specs

Include trail certifications or waxless base documentation for customs valuation and compliance
